Кодировка при чтении файла .txt - C#
Формулировка задачи:
Возникла проблема с кодировкой при выводе в консоль, как исправить?
using System; using System.IO; class Test { static void Main() { string a,way; way = File.ReadAllText(@"D:\дни рождения друзей.txt"); Console.WriteLine(way); a = Console.ReadLine(); } }
Решение задачи: «Кодировка при чтении файла .txt»
textual
Листинг программы
FileStream MainFile = new FileStream(@"d:\C#.txt", FileMode.Open, FileAccess.Read); StreamReader reader = new StreamReader(MainFile, Encoding.GetEncoding(1251)); Console.WriteLine(reader.ReadToEnd()); reader.Close();
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д